I initially interpreted "automated testing tool" to be what you seem to be 
thinking: a tool that simulates users.

As I read the thread, I'm thinking the original poster was actually asking 
about "automated test data collection" tools, like those offered by Keynote 
(formerly Vividence and NetRaker). These have real users. It's the data 
that's collected.
